Admission: The teachers at our college are really smart and know a lot. Around 60% of students pass the semester exams. The teaching is good, but not always worth the money. Some teachers are super helpful and will clear up any doubts we have. But there are a few who have big egos.

Placement: Around 75% of students in our college are getting job placements. We have local companies like Patel Solar and Ramesh Steel coming for recruitment, but big companies like Reliance, Tata, and L&T haven't visited yet. Essar does come, but they only hire girls. The main job role I've heard about is as an operator.

Campus: The campus has a canteen, Wi-Fi, computer labs, and a library. Unfortunately, there are no hostels. They also have sports rooms and medical facilities. Each subject has its own lab like machines and power electronics. The Wi-Fi is there, but it's a bit spotty. Overall, some facilities are there, but they need some fixing.

Placement: Around half of the students passed their exams, but not many got placements in Computer Engineering and Information Technology. However, a few lucky ones did get high-paying jobs, earning around 30-40 Lakh per year. The college has a trading and placement cell, but it's not very active.

Campus: The classrooms and buildings are nice, but there's no hostel. Wi-Fi is slow and not everywhere on campus. The library has books, but no working computers. The canteen is big, but it's always closed. They do have all the labs though.
